  2. giv·er

    • 1. One that gives: a giver of gifts.
    • 2. A donor or contributor. Often used in combination: almsgivers.

    These words refer to a person who gives something. The word giver is usually used with a noun saying what is being given. When it is used on its own it usually refers to a person who gives money to a charity or political party. Women are the primary gift givers in households.

    The word you want, I suspect, is donor, but that would apply mostly to charitable giving. Another possibility is benefactor, though it is more frequently used nowadays to refer to those who leave money in wills.
